How does the WMD Utility Parametric EQ differ from a graphic EQ pedal?
-
Unlike a graphic EQ, which uses fixed frequency bands, the WMD Utility Parametric EQ allows you to select specific frequencies, adjust gain, and modify bandwidth for more detailed sound shaping.

Use cases and applications
-
Utilizing a parametric EQ post-distortion can smooth out harshness in specific frequency bands, particularly effective with hard clipping distortion pedals.
Source -
A parametric EQ is used to emulate a cocked wah effect by setting a high Q and maxing out mid frequencies, offering versatility beyond traditional EQ applications.
Source -
The EQ’s ability to compensate tonal shifts from down-tuning effects like the Digitech Drop is noted, with a slight mid-high boost effectively correcting the tone.
Source -
A parametric EQ can transform a humbucker guitar’s sound to mimic a single-coil guitar, offering tonal flexibility for players with diverse pickup preferences.
